Understanding how these systems work, their limitations, and best practices for their use helps you make fair, informed decisions about academic integrity in your classroom.<\/p>\n<div id=\"ez-toc-container\" class=\"ez-toc-v2_0_50 counter-hierarchy ez-toc-counter ez-toc-grey ez-toc-container-direction\">\n<div class=\"ez-toc-title-container\">\n<p class=\"ez-toc-title\">Table of Contents<\/p>\n<span class=\"ez-toc-title-toggle\"><a href=\"#\" class=\"ez-toc-pull-right ez-toc-btn ez-toc-btn-xs ez-toc-btn-default ez-toc-toggle\" aria-label=\"Toggle Table of Content\" role=\"button\"><label for=\"item-6a25db630af47\" aria-hidden=\"true\"><span style=\"display: flex;align-items: center;width: 35px;height: 30px;justify-content: center;direction:ltr;\"><svg style=\"fill: #999;color:#999\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\" class=\"list-377408\" width=\"20px\" height=\"20px\" viewBox=\"0 0 24 24\" fill=\"none\"><path d=\"M6 6H4v2h2V6zm14 0H8v2h12V6zM4 11h2v2H4v-2zm16 0H8v2h12v-2zM4 16h2v2H4v-2zm16 0H8v2h12v-2z\" fill=\"currentColor\"><\/path><\/svg><svg style=\"fill: #999;color:#999\" class=\"arrow-unsorted-368013\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\" width=\"10px\" height=\"10px\" viewBox=\"0 0 24 24\" version=\"1.2\" baseProfile=\"tiny\"><path d=\"M18.2 9.3l-6.2-6.3-6.2 6.3c-.2.2-.3.4-.3.7s.1.5.3.7c.2.2.4.3.7.3h11c.3 0 .5-.1.7-.3.2-.2.3-.5.3-.7s-.1-.5-.3-.7zM5.8 14.7l6.2 6.3 6.2-6.3c.2-.2.3-.5.3-.7s-.1-.5-.3-.7c-.2-.2-.4-.3-.7-.3h-11c-.3 0-.5.1-.7.3-.2.2-.3.5-.3.7s.1.5.3.7z\"\/><\/svg><\/span><\/label><input  type=\"checkbox\" id=\"item-6a25db630af47\"><\/a><\/span><\/div>\n<nav><ul class='ez-toc-list ez-toc-list-level-1 ' ><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-1\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#How_Detection_Technology_Works_in_2026\" title=\"How Detection Technology Works in 2026\">How Detection Technology Works in 2026<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-2\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#Understanding_False_Positive_Rates\" title=\"Understanding False Positive Rates\">Understanding False Positive Rates<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-3\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#When_to_Trust_Detection_Results\" title=\"When to Trust Detection Results\">When to Trust Detection Results<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-4\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#Building_Detection-Resistant_Assignments\" title=\"Building Detection-Resistant Assignments\">Building Detection-Resistant Assignments<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-5\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#Creating_Clear_AI_Use_Policies\" title=\"Creating Clear AI Use Policies\">Creating Clear AI Use Policies<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-6\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#Teaching_Digital_Literacy_and_Ethics\" title=\"Teaching Digital Literacy and Ethics\">Teaching Digital Literacy and Ethics<\/a><\/li><li class='ez-toc-page-1 ez-toc-heading-level-2'><a class=\"ez-toc-link ez-toc-heading-7\" href=\"https:\/\/www.trinka.ai\/blog\/ai-content-detection-what-educators-need-to-know-in-2026\/#Responding_to_Suspected_AI_Use\" title=\"Responding to Suspected AI Use\">Responding to Suspected AI Use<\/a><\/li><\/ul><\/nav><\/div>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"How_Detection_Technology_Works_in_2026\"><\/span>How Detection Technology Works in 2026<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">AI detectors analyze patterns in text. They look at word choice predictability, sentence structure uniformity, and stylistic consistency. The technology compares submitted text against patterns learned from millions of AI-generated samples during training.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Detection algorithms assign probability scores rather than definitive answers. A score of 85% means the system thinks the text has an 85% chance of being AI-generated. This probabilistic nature creates uncertainty. No detector offers 100% accuracy.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Current systems struggle with mixed content where students write original work but use AI for editing or specific sections. The detector sees AI patterns without knowing whether they represent generation or revision. This limitation creates the biggest challenge for fair assessment.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"Understanding_False_Positive_Rates\"><\/span>Understanding False Positive Rates<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Studies from late 2025 show false positive rates ranging from 5% to 15% depending on the detector and text type. For a class of 30 students, this means 1 to 4 students might get wrongly flagged for AI use on any given assignment.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Certain student populations face higher false positive rates. Non-native English speakers who learned formal grammar through instruction often write in patterns resembling AI output. Students with strong writing skills produce clear, well-structured prose that detectors sometimes misidentify as machine generated.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Technical and scientific writing triggers false positives more frequently. These genres require formal language and standardized terminology. The resulting uniformity mirrors AI-generated academic writing, causing detection errors.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"When_to_Trust_Detection_Results\"><\/span>When to Trust Detection Results<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">High-confidence scores above 90% warrant investigation but not immediate conclusions. Check the flagged content against the student&#8217;s previous work. Look for sudden changes in writing quality, vocabulary sophistication, or style consistency.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Request a conversation with the student about their writing process. Ask specific questions about their research, outline development, and revision choices. Genuine authors discuss their work naturally and explain specific decisions. Students who used AI extensively struggle to explain choices they didn&#8217;t make.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Consider assignment context. Take-home essays allow more AI use opportunity than in-class writing. Compare the flagged work against timed writing samples you know the student produced independently.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"Building_Detection-Resistant_Assignments\"><\/span>Building Detection-Resistant Assignments<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Design assignments where AI tools provide limited value. Ask students to connect course material to personal experiences AI systems cannot access. Include requirements for specific class discussions, local examples, or individual research interviews.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Incorporate process documentation into assignments. Require students to submit outlines, rough drafts, and revision notes alongside final papers. This documentation reveals authentic writing development over time.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Use scaffolded assignments with staged deadlines. Breaking large projects into proposal, draft, and final versions with feedback between stages makes wholesale AI generation impractical. Students benefit from structure while you gain insight into their process.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"Creating_Clear_AI_Use_Policies\"><\/span>Creating Clear AI Use Policies<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Students need explicit guidance on acceptable AI use in your course. Specify which tools students may use and for what purposes. Allow grammar checking but prohibit content generation or permit brainstorming assistance but require original writing.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Explain your reasoning for these policies. Students understand restrictions better when they grasp the learning goals at stake. If you want them to develop research skills, explain why AI-generated literature reviews undermine this objective.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Update policies based on student questions and emerging scenarios. The AI tool environment changes constantly. Revisit guidelines each semester and address new situations as they arise.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"Teaching_Digital_Literacy_and_Ethics\"><\/span>Teaching Digital Literacy and Ethics<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Help students understand detection technology limitations and capabilities. Discuss false positives, explain how detectors work, and acknowledge uncertainty in results. This transparency builds trust and encourages honest communication.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Frame AI use as an ethical choice rather than a detection avoidance problem. Students who understand why original work matters make better decisions than those who simply fear getting caught. Discuss long-term consequences of outsourcing thinking to AI systems.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Teach appropriate AI tool use as a skill. Show students how to use AI for brainstorming, outline checking, and editing while maintaining authorship and intellectual engagement. These skills serve them after graduation when AI use becomes routine in many careers.<\/p>\n<h2 class=\"text-text-100 mt-3 -mb-1 text-[1.125rem] font-bold\"><span class=\"ez-toc-section\" id=\"Responding_to_Suspected_AI_Use\"><\/span>Responding to Suspected AI Use<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Start with curiosity rather than accusation. Express concern about the flagged work and ask the student to explain their process. Many situations resolve when students provide documentation or discuss their work convincingly.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Focus on learning opportunities. If a student did use AI inappropriately, understand why they made this choice. Time pressure, lack of confidence, or misunderstanding of expectations often drive these decisions. Address underlying issues alongside academic integrity concerns.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Document everything. Keep records of detection scores, student conversations, and any evidence you gather. If the situation escalates to formal proceedings, thorough documentation protects both you and the student.<\/p>\n<p class=\"font-claude-response-body break-words whitespace-normal leading-[1.7]\">Trinka&#8217;s free <a href=\"https:\/\/www.trinka.ai\/ai-content-detector\">AI content detector<\/a> supports fair evaluation practices.
